A Flash of Green - First Edition - John D MacDonald

In this fast-pacing, exciting novel, John D. MacDonald brings his storytelling magic to a larger and more ambitious theme than any he has yet considered. The question is this: Can a town resist the pressures of irresponsible get-rich-quick operators, or are progress and crowding and ugliness inevitable? The answers strike deep into one particular communitys roots and arouse some strong emotions from acrimonious town meetings to blackmail, assault, and even attempted murder.

*From the blurb.


I.Hard Cover. Condition: Very Good to Fine.

II.Brown buckram boards. Corners very lightly bumped, some scuffing along the edges, otherwise in Very Good condition.  Silver titling on spine.

III.Text block intact, contents are clean, clear and bright. Pages lightly yellowed from age. 

IV.Dust Jacket in Very Good Condition. Much shelf wear along the edges, nicked and some small tears on spine ends and corners. Otherwise in Very Good condition. 

V.Published by Robert Hale & Company & Co Ltd, London, 1971.

VI.Binding Condition: Very Good.

VII.Overall Condition: Very Good.

VIII.Size: Crown Octavo (8vo), 202 mm X 132 mm X 24 mm.

IX.252 pages.
